Recognition
Awards received include Cross of Liberty, 2nd Class[6], a grade of an order[23], in Finland[24], founded in 1918[25]; Cross of Liberty, 3rd Class[8], a grade of an order[26], in Finland[27], founded in 1918[28]; Memorial medal of the Winter War[9], a campaign medal[29], in Finland[30], founded in 1940[31]; Memorial medal of the Continuation War[10], a campaign medal[32], in Finland[33], founded in 1957[34]; Medal of Merit of the Civil Defence[11], an award[35], in Finland[36], founded in 1940[37]; and Iron Cross 2nd Class[38], a grade of an order[39].
